+ // If we're instrumenting a block with a musttail call, the check has to be
+ // inserted before the call rather than between it and the return. The
+ // verifier guarantees that a musttail call is either directly before the
+ // return or with a single correct bitcast of the return value in between so
+ // we don't need to worry about many situations here.
+ Instruction *CheckLoc = RI;
+ Instruction *Prev = RI->getPrevNonDebugInstruction();
+ if (Prev && isa<CallInst>(Prev) && cast<CallInst>(Prev)->isMustTailCall())
+ CheckLoc = Prev;
+ else if (Prev) {
+ Prev = Prev->getPrevNonDebugInstruction();
+ if (Prev && isa<CallInst>(Prev) && cast<CallInst>(Prev)->isMustTailCall())
+ CheckLoc = Prev;
+ }
